CNC Swiss Machining Tolerances & Surface Finish
Turned Grade 9 Titanium holds diameter tolerances to about ±0.005 mm with concentricity within 0.01 mm and good roundness. Turned finishes of Ra 0.4–0.8 µm are achievable with finishing passes and sharp tooling.
Exact achievable figures depend on the alloy, the feature size and the part geometry. Tell us which dimensions are critical and we will advise feasibility up front.

What is CNC Swiss Machining Grade 9 Titanium and how is it done?
CNC Swiss Machining Grade 9 Titanium refers to swiss-type machining guides bar stock through a sliding headstock for high-accuracy small, slender parts.
